An analysis of the ecological and technical condition of the inventory of functioning burners such as GP, GIK, etc., that may be operated at domestic refineries is given. Their structural and operational shortcomings are presented. The authors own technical designs for reconstruction of GP burners to improve the efficiency of co-combustion of oil refinery gases and fuel oil in a single housing with low discharge of toxic nitric oxides are proposed. Recommendations on the use of the new burner design with cocombustionor with separate combustion of liquid and gaseous fuels are developed.
